The European Commission launched a public consultation on the role of
“Internet platforms”
<http://edri.limequery.org/index.php/346935/lang-en>. Its outcome will
become the basis for new EU legislative proposals on online law
enforcement, data protection, privacy, open data and copyright. These
are likely to have an impact internationally, so this is a chance to
shape EU policy!

Tips:
- You don’t have to answer every question (apart from the mandatory
questions on the first page)
- We have colour-coded the questions (green for general questions; red
for data protection...). So, if data protection is the only issue that
you’re interested in, just click through the guide and answer the
questions tagged as “data protection”.
- The consultation is very long. You have the option to save your
answers and continue later.
- You can respond as an individual or as an organisation
- If you want to submit your response via our tool
<http://edri.limequery.org/index.php/346935/lang-en>, please use it
before 24 December, 23:59. You can also respond directly through the
Commission's website until 31 December:
https://ec.europa.eu/eusurvey/runner/Platforms/
